本文目录导读:
在当今数字化时代,拥有一个功能齐全、高效运行的PHP网站对于任何企业或个人来说都是至关重要的,如何正确地安装和配置PHP网站源码?本文将为您详细介绍这一过程。
准备工作
选择合适的操作系统
您需要选择一个适合运行PHP网站的操作系统,目前市面上流行的有Windows、Linux和macOS等,Linux由于其稳定性和安全性被广泛使用,因此我们以Ubuntu为例进行说明。
图片来源于网络,如有侵权联系删除
安装Ubuntu
- 下载与启动:访问Ubuntu官网下载最新版本的Ubuntu镜像文件。
- 创建U盘启动盘:使用工具如Rufus将Ubuntu镜像写入到U盘中。
- 设置BIOS:确保计算机支持从USB启动,并在BIOS中将启动顺序设置为优先级最高。
- 引导安装:插入U盘后重启电脑,按照提示进行安装。
配置服务器环境
成功安装Ubuntu后,我们需要为其配置必要的服务器软件来支持PHP应用程序的开发和部署。
安装Apache服务器
- 打开终端(Ctrl+Alt+T),输入以下命令:
sudo apt-get update sudo apt-get install apache2
- 启动并验证Apache服务:
sudo systemctl start apache2 sudo systemctl enable apache2
安装PHP及其扩展模块
- 使用apt-get安装PHP及常用扩展:
sudo apt-get install php libapache2-mod-php php-mysql php-gd php-zip php-curl php-json php-mbstring php-bcmath php-xml
测试站点可用性
完成上述步骤后,可以通过浏览器访问http://localhost/
来测试是否成功搭建了基本的Web服务器环境。
安装PHP网站源码
获取源代码
通常情况下,您可以从GitHub或其他代码托管平台获取所需的PHP网站源码,假设我们要安装WordPress博客系统:
- 访问WordPress GitHub仓库。
- 点击“Code”按钮,选择克隆仓库或者直接下载zip包。
解压并上传至服务器
将下载好的源码解压缩到一个目录下,然后通过FTP客户端将其上传至服务器的根目录(通常是/var/www/html/)。
配置数据库连接
大多数PHP网站都需要数据库支持,因此接下来我们需要为它们配置相应的数据库连接信息。
创建新数据库
- 在MySQL中创建一个新的数据库:
CREATE DATABASE mysite; USE mysite;
编辑配置文件
找到网站根目录下的配置文件(如wp-config.php),在其中填写正确的数据库参数:
图片来源于网络,如有侵权联系删除
define('DB_NAME', 'mysite'); define('DB_USER', 'root'); // 默认用户名 define('DB_PASSWORD', ''); // 空密码 define('DB_HOST', 'localhost');
完成安装流程
现在可以打开浏览器,导航到http://localhost/
,按照屏幕上的指示逐步完成安装过程。
后续优化与维护
定期更新安全补丁
为了保护网站免受潜在的安全威胁,务必定期检查并及时应用最新的安全补丁。
监控性能指标
利用工具如New Relic监控网站的响应时间和资源消耗情况,以便及时发现并解决性能瓶颈问题。
备份重要数据
定期备份网站的数据和配置文件,以防不测事件导致数据丢失。
通过以上步骤,您可以轻松地在本地环境中搭建并运行一个完整的PHP网站,这不仅有助于快速开发和调试项目,还能让您更好地理解整个开发流程和技术栈的工作原理,随着经验的积累和对技术的深入了解,相信您能成为一名优秀的Web开发者!
标签: #php网站源码安装教程
评论列表